A person had to be cut out of their car by fire crews who attended a collision on a busy Norfolk road this morning.
Emergency services were called to the scene of the accident on the A1075 near Great Hockham at 10.10am.
Once at the scene, fire crews used hydraulic rescue equipment to release the casualty who was trapped in one of the vehicles.
Members of the fire service also carried out casualty care and made sure the scene of the accident was safe.
